Day 1: The Open Door to the Courtroom of Heaven
Theme: The torn veil—our access to the Father.
Scriptures:
- Matthew 27:51 (ESV) “And behold, the curtain of the temple was torn in two, from top to bottom. And the earth shook, and the rocks were split.”
- Hebrews 10:19-20 (ESV) “Therefore, brothers, since we have confidence to enter the holy places by the blood of Jesus, by the new and living way that he opened for us through the curtain, that is, through his flesh,”
Reflection:
The veil in the temple represented separation between humanity and God. When Jesus died, that veil was torn, symbolizing the removal of every barrier. We now have bold access to His throne of grace, not in fear but in faith. As we step into this new year, let us embrace this incredible privilege and approach Him with hearts open to repentance and renewal.
Devotional Thought:
Picture the moment Jesus died and the veil in the temple was torn from top to bottom. That dramatic event symbolizes our access to God through Christ. Reflect on how Jesus’ sacrifice has made a way for you to come boldly before the Father, free from barriers. Take a moment to thank Him for this incredible privilege.
